1 KEYNOTE SPEAKERS JARMO AHONEN In tennis Ahonen has been a personal physiotherapist and fitness coach for Jarkko Nieminen and Robert Lindstedt ( ). Furthermore, he has been the Davis Cup team physiotherapist and fitness coach. Ahonen is author of 11 sports and physiotherapy related books. Jarmo Ahonen holds a degree in physiotherapy at the Helsinki IV College of Health Sciences. He obtained his degree after doing pre-physiotherapy studies at California State University Fresno (USA). From 1977 to 1994 Ahonen was the team physiotherapist of the Finnish Track and Field Association. During that time he also coached pole vaulters in athletics for several years. From 1986 till 2012 he was a consulting physiotherapist and fitness coach for the Finnish National Ballet. In addition, he is a seven times Olympian Physiotherapist with the Finnish Olympic team. Currently, he is member of the Finnish National Olympic Committee (Medical Board). 2 NICK BOLLETIERI Nick Bollettieri is one of the most influential people in the world of tennis and a legend who has transcended the sport. In 1978, he founded the Nick Bollettieri Tennis Academy in Florida, which is now the IMG Academy Bollettieri Tennis Program. The Academy was the first full-time tennis boarding school to combine intense training on the court with a custom-designed academic curriculum. He has coached ten former #1 players in the world - Agassi, Becker, Courier, Hingis, Jankovic, Rios, Seles, Sharapova and Venus and Serena Williams, as well as a multitude of other worldclass players, including: Haas, Kournikova, Arias and Vaidisova, to name a few. His Academy has become synonymous with tennis excellence and its coaches and students continue to reflect Nick's passion for excellence and the game. 5 BRUCE ELLIOTT Professor Bruce C. Elliott (PhD, FACHPER, FISBS, FAAKPE) is an Emeritus Professor and Senior Research Fellow within the School of Sport Science, Exercise and Health, at the University of Western Australia. Generally considered a world leader in research into sport biomechanics, particularly tennis stroke production, he has co-edited the ITF publications Biomechanics of Advanced Tennis (2003) and Technique Development in Tennis Stroke Production (2009). He has published over 220 refereed articles in journals and 100 refereed Conference Proceedings, as well as over 50 book chapters or books, all in the general area of sports biomechanics. He was the organiser of the applied research Projects at the Sydney 2000 Olympics, one of which was on shoulder loading in the tennis serve. He is a past president ( ) of the International Society of Biomechanics in Sports and sits on the Coaching Advisory Panel of Tennis Australia. In 1999 he was honoured with the Award of Merit by the Western Australian Sports Federation and in 2003 the Professional Tennis Registry gave him the Stanley Plagenhoef Sport Science Award for his lifetime contribution to tennis and the Australian Government awarded him their Centenary Medal for service to sport policy and research development for sport. TOM GULLIKSON Gullikson of Palm Coast, Fla., began his coaching career shortly after his retirement from playing and became one of the earliest USTA Player Development coaches, where he coached Jim Courier, Todd Martin and Jennifer Capriati, among others. He later served as the program s Director of Coaching from 1997 to Gullikson also served as U.S. Davis Cup captain from and led the 1995 team to the Davis Cup title. Additionally, he was the men s coach during the 1996 Olympic Games in Atlanta, where he helped Andre Agassi win the men s singles gold medal. Gullikson made his professional debut at the 1976 French Open, and over the course of his career, he captured 15 doubles titles (10 with identical twin brother Tim) and one singles title. He and Tim reached the Wimbledon doubles final in 1983, and one year later, he won the US Open mixed doubles title with partner Manuela Maleeva. That same year, he achieved careerhigh rankings of No. 34 in singles and No. 9 in doubles.

JOSE HIGUERAS Higueras joined the USTA coaching staff in 2008 after being hired by Patrick McEnroe to oversee all of Player Development s coaching efforts. Higueras has worked with a number of the world s best players both past and present, including Pete Sampras, Jim Courier, Roger Federer, Jennifer Capriati and Mary Joe Fernandez. He was also Michael Chang s coach when Chang won the French Open at age 17. As a professional, Higueras won 16 ATP singles titles and was ranked as high as No. 6 in the world. He reached the semifinals at Roland Garros in back-to-back years in 1982 and 1983, and he received the ATP Sportsmanship Award in Higueras was also a mainstay on the Spanish Davis Cup team, playing for eight years. Since joining the USTA, Higueras has worked with USTA Player Development General Manager Patrick McEnroe to develop an overall strategic approach that best identifies and develops future American champions. He has also travelled the country scouting top junior talent and providing on-court guidance to players and coaches alike.

PATRICK MCENROE Patrick McEnroe is the General Manager of USTA Player Development, a position he assumed in April In this role, McEnroe oversees all of USTA Player Development s operations including the USTA s national coaches and coaching program.since taking over USTA Player Development, McEnroe has established a cohesive, comprehensive strategic approach that best identifies, trains and develops future American world-class players, with an emphasis on inclusiveness and the development of players and coaches who excel on all surfaces and in all situations. McEnroe served as the U.S. Davis Cup captain from 2001 to 2010, making him the longest-serving captain in U.S. history. McEnroe is credited with bringing aboard a new crop of young talent including Andy Roddick, James Blake and the Bryan brothers when he assumed the captaincy, and he led that group to the Davis Cup championship in 2007.Overall, McEnroe captained the team to the semifinals or better on five occasions, and his 18 total victories as captain tie him with Tom Gorman for the most in U.S. Davis Cup history. He also coached the 2004 U.S. Olympic men s tennis team.
